<b>Abstract</b>— <p>A series of works by Professor A.P. Kozlov, published in the journals <i>Advances in Current Biology</i> and <i>Paleontological Journal</i> in 2024, is devoted to fundamental issues of the evolutionary development of living organisms, the analysis of which is based on the role of inherited tumors as a natural mechanism for the formation of evolutionarily new tissues and organs. The study of this mechanism is the basis for the theory of carcino-evo-devo, which, according to the author, explains the process of increasing the biologi­cal complexity of living organisms. In this review the conclusions from the new chapters of A.P. Kozlov’s theory concerning the increasing complexity of living organisms from the standpoint of computer science and information technology are analyzed.</p>
